Swollen ankles are very common among older people. Sometimes even young people suffer from this disease. There can be many possible reasons for swollen ankles. Some of the main and most relevant causes for swollen ankles are as follows:

Trauma
Injury on ankle
Sprained ankle
Venous insufficiency
Lymph edema
Arthritis
Heart disease
Kidney disease
Liver disease
Infection
Tumor
